Objectives:

Small and medium sized airports are crucial for regional accessibility and competitiveness, however at the same time European policies and national set strict environment targets.

Green Airports aims to develop strategies and solutions for a more eco-efficient, sustainable and green regional aviation. Tackling the challenges of regional accessibility, sustainability and regulation Green Airports is modelled to decrease green house gas and noise emissions as well as operation specific waste volumes, to increase energy efficiency and surface accessibility of airports by innovative concepts on public transportation.

As cross sectional objective the project comprehensively focuses on regional airport communication, regional cooperation and policy resolutions to safeguard the role of regional airports as accessibility gateways by improving public perception and acceptance.
